LA Squads Meet Again

In all competitions, these teams have played three separate times this year.

The Galaxy hosted LAFC in MLS play back in April, where they were outplayed and lost 3-2 on their home turf.

The Galaxy would get their revenge a month later in the U.S Open Cup, where they beat LAFC on the road 2-0.

Their next meeting came on July 4th, where once again, the Galaxy beat LAFC 2-1 in front of their home crowd.
